Transaction 2f58d91f98dc9a4da318b014451a231a22b01aecec2ff8b570d30fad8944498d
1 Input
2 Outputs
- 2f58d91f98dc9a4da318b014451a231a22b01aecec2ff8b570d30fad8944498d:0
- 2f58d91f98dc9a4da318b014451a231a22b01aecec2ff8b570d30fad8944498d:1
value 3048417
address 3LdQiBVkWyZQ3QTT2wxYQSkpvHd6M13h4V
value 7250655
address 1Ke5h5YgWNcML11DnHWbgPSSkdLMtEQXRb